Wine Description

Domaine Thillardon's Moulin-à-Vent Sous la Roche is a precise, elegant expression of the Moulin-à-Vent appellation. The vines, planted on pink granite soil, benefit from privileged exposure, contributing to the wine's finesse and depth. The "Sous la Roche" parcel is located on a steep slope that favors natural drainage and optimal ripeness. The grapes, grown according to biodynamic principles and vinified without the addition of sulfur, are a hallmark of the wine estate.

Philippe Mischler, sommelier at Mundovin : This Moulin à Vent Sous la Roche is marked by aromatic purity and great expression of terroir. Its natural winemaking gives a silky structure and well-integrated tannins, while highlighting bright fruit and mineral notes. The bedrock outcrops on these plots naturally limit the vigor of the vines, favoring optimal concentration of the grapes.
